Viewing stories

When you capture or save images and videos, the device will read their date and location tags, sort the images and videos, and then create stories. To create stories automatically, you must capture or save multiple images and videos.

Creating stories

Create stories with various themes.

On the Apps screen, tap Gallery STORIES.

Tap Create story.

Tick images or videos to include in the story and tap DONE.

Enter a title for the story and tap CREATE.

To add images or videos to a story, select a story and tap ADD.

To remove images or videos from a story, select a story, tap Edit, tick images or videos to remove, and then tap Remove from story.

Deleting stories

On the Apps screen, tap Gallery STORIES.

Tap and hold a story to delete, and tap DELETE.

Syncing images and videos with Samsung Cloud

You can sync images and videos saved in Gallery with Samsung Cloud and access them from other devices. You must register and sign in to your Samsung account to use Samsung Cloud. Refer to Samsung account for more information.

On the Apps screen, tap Gallery Settings and tap the Samsung Cloud switch to activate it. Images and videos captured on the device will be automatically saved to Samsung Cloud.

The Samsung SM-T580NZWAITV and SM-T580NZAEITV tablets belong to the Galaxy Tab A series, offering a premium experience that balances performance, design, and usability. These tablets are designed for users seeking a versatile device that excels for both entertainment and productivity.

One of the standout features of the SM-T580 series is its large 10.1-inch display, which boasts a WUXGA resolution of 1920x1200 pixels. This high-resolution screen provides vibrant colors and sharp details, making it perfect for streaming videos, browsing websites, or enjoying e-books. The IPS LCD technology ensures wide viewing angles, allowing multiple users to enjoy content simultaneously without any loss of quality.

Powering the SM-T580 is the efficient Exynos 7870 Octa-core processor, which enhances multitasking and app performance. Coupled with either 2GB or 3GB of RAM, depending on the model, users can expect smooth operation whether they are gaming, working on documents, or switching between applications. The device also features 16GB or 32GB of internal storage, expandable via a microSD card slot, permitting users to store a vast array of files, applications, and games without worrying about running out of space.

In terms of connectivity, the tablets support Wi-Fi capabilities, ensuring that users stay connected wherever they go. Optional LTE capabilities are available for models that support mobile data, making it ideal for on-the-go professionals and students alike.

Audio is another highlight, with dual speakers that provide a rich, immersive sound experience. This feature is particularly beneficial for movie lovers and music enthusiasts. The tablets also include a long-lasting battery that supports up to 13 hours of video playback, ensuring that users can enjoy their device throughout the day without frequent recharges.

On the software front, the SM-T580 comes equipped with Samsung's user-friendly interface built on Android, offering a wealth of apps and services that enhance productivity and entertainment.
